How they compare
Bangladesh currently reports 26,310 number against 18,847 number in Niger, a difference of 7,463 number.
That makes Bangladesh's figure about 1.4 times Niger's.
Across all 15 years both countries report, Bangladesh has been ahead every year.
Bangladesh ranks 12th and Niger ranks 15th of 182 countries.
Bangladesh has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bangladesh | Niger |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 49,743 number | 1,413 number | 48,330 number | Bangladesh |
| 2000s | 47,988 number | 2,968 number | 45,019 number | Bangladesh |
| 2010s | 22,719 number | 10,300 number | 12,418 number | Bangladesh |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
